How To Fix /SAPAPO/VMI_APO012 - Enter a sold-to party


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SAPAPO/VMI_APO -

  • Message number: 012

  • Message text: Enter a sold-to party

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SAPAPO/VMI_APO012 - Enter a sold-to party ?

    The SAP error message /SAPAPO/VMI_APO012 Enter a sold-to party typically occurs in the context of S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O), particularly when dealing with Vendor Managed Inventory (VMI) scenarios. This error indicates that a sold-to party (customer) has not been specified in the relevant transaction or configuration.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Sold-to Party: The sold-to party field is required for the transaction you are trying to execute, but it has not been filled in.
    2.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of the VMI setup, where the sold-to party is not properly defined or linked to the relevant materials or products.
    3. Data Entry Error: The user may have overlooked entering the sold-to party in the transaction screen.

    Solution:

    1. Enter Sold-to Party: Ensure that you enter a valid sold-to party in the relevant field. This is typically done in the transaction screen where you are processing the VMI data.
    2. Check Master Data: Verify that the sold-to party is correctly defined in the customer master data. You can do this by navigating to the customer master record in SAP and ensuring that all necessary details are filled out.
    3. Review VMI Configuration: Check the VMI configuration settings to ensure that the sold-to party is correctly assigned to the relevant materials and that all necessary settings are in place.
    4.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on the VMI setup and requirements for sold-to parties.
    5. User Training: If this error is frequently encountered, consider providing additional training for users on the importance of entering the sold-to party and how to do it correctly.
